The motivation is to simplify the interpreter and > garbage collector and speed it up slightly, and to simplify potential > future changes. I like the idea, but: AFAIK the main issue with pseudovectors is that their allocation is slower and suffers more from fragmentation (because we don't use a size-segregated allocation algorithm (like Linux's SLAB, for example) for them). Are you sure the new code is faster overall? There is also a potential issue in terms of the resulting heap size of markers (which may bump up from 6 words to 8 words, IIRC, unless your patch does something to keep it down to 6), tho this is probably of no real consequence.
